Transaction d94e24a721fdd0130fa8cd77337f3ae3386aa1c1d68e261186ade88e463310a4
1 Input
1 Output
-
d94e24a721fdd0130fa8cd77337f3ae3386aa1c1d68e261186ade88e463310a4:0
- value
- 655006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 875dbb8ef05cd0dcf36c769f1c71d2421e4bddda OP_EQUAL
- address
- 3E2mS6j8484iTcTZMJ6FbadFXPDFTeDMrE